如何发布一个html5网页

如何发布一个html5网页

发布一个HTML5网页的过程包括以下核心步骤:编写网页代码、选择合适的Web主机、上传文件到服务器、设置域名解析。其中,选择合适的Web主机是非常关键的一步,它直接影响到网页的访问速度和用户体验。

一、编写网页代码

1. HTML5基础结构

在开始发布一个HTML5网页之前,首先需要编写网页的代码。HTML5是最新的HTML标准,它提供了一些新的元素和属性,使网页编写更加简洁和功能强大。以下是一个简单的HTML5网页结构:

<!DOCTYPE html>

<html lang="en">

<head>

<meta charset="UTF-8">

<meta name="viewport" content="width=device-width, initial-scale=1.0">

<title>My HTML5 Page</title>

</head>

<body>

<header>

<h1>Welcome to My HTML5 Page</h1>

</header>

<main>

<p>This is a paragraph in the main content area.</p>

</main>

<footer>

<p>Footer information goes here.</p>

</footer>

</body>

</html>

这个基础结构包括了文档类型声明、语言属性、字符集声明、视口设置、标题、页眉、主要内容区和页脚。

2. 添加CSS和JavaScript

为了使网页更具吸引力和交互性,可以添加CSS样式和JavaScript脚本。以下是如何在HTML5中嵌入CSS和JavaScript的示例:

<head>

<meta charset="UTF-8">

<meta name="viewport" content="width=device-width, initial-scale=1.0">

<title>My HTML5 Page</title>

<style>

body {

font-family: Arial, sans-serif;

margin: 0;

padding: 0;

background-color: #f4f4f4;

}

header, footer {

background-color: #333;

color: white;

text-align: center;

padding: 1em;

}

main {

padding: 2em;

}

</style>

</head>

<body>

<!-- Previous HTML content here -->

<script>

document.addEventListener('DOMContentLoaded', (event) => {

console.log('The page has fully loaded');

});

</script>

</body>

二、选择合适的Web主机

1. 免费与付费主机

发布HTML5网页需要一个Web主机来存储网页文件并提供网络访问。Web主机分为免费和付费两种类型。

  • 免费主机:适合初学者和小型项目,但通常带有广告和有限的资源。例如:000webhost、InfinityFree。
  • 付费主机:适合专业和商业用途,提供更可靠的服务和支持。例如:Bluehost、SiteGround。

2. 主机类型

不同类型的Web主机适用于不同的需求:

  • 共享主机:多个网站共享一个服务器,价格低廉,适合小型网站。
  • VPS主机:提供独立的虚拟环境,性能和控制更好,适合中等规模的网站。
  • 专用主机:独占一台服务器,性能最佳,适合大型网站和高流量应用。

三、上传文件到服务器

1. 使用FTP客户端

文件传输协议(FTP)是将文件上传到服务器的常用方法。以下是使用FTP客户端(如FileZilla)的步骤:

  1. 下载并安装FileZilla
  2. 设置FTP账户:在Web主机控制面板中创建FTP账户。
  3. 连接到服务器:在FileZilla中输入主机名、用户名和密码,点击"快速连接"。
  4. 上传文件:拖放本地文件到服务器上的目标目录(通常是public_html或www)。

2. 使用Web主机控制面板

许多Web主机提供了基于Web的文件管理器,可以通过浏览器上传文件:

  1. 登录控制面板:例如cPanel或Plesk。
  2. 导航到文件管理器
  3. 上传文件:选择目标目录并上传HTML、CSS、JavaScript文件。

四、设置域名解析

1. 注册域名

发布一个HTML5网页需要一个域名。可以通过域名注册商(如GoDaddy、Namecheap)注册一个新域名。选择一个简短、易记的域名有助于提高网站的访问量。

2. 域名与主机绑定

在域名注册商处,将域名指向Web主机:

  1. 获取DNS信息:从Web主机获取DNS服务器地址。
  2. 更新域名DNS设置:在域名注册商的管理面板中,将域名的DNS服务器更新为Web主机提供的地址。

3. 测试域名解析

域名解析可能需要一些时间(通常24-48小时),完成后可以通过在浏览器中输入域名来测试网页是否能正确访问。

五、优化和维护

1. SEO优化

为了提高网页在搜索引擎中的排名,可以进行以下优化:

  • 关键字优化:在网页标题、描述和内容中合理使用关键字。
  • 高质量内容:提供有价值的信息,吸引用户和搜索引擎。
  • 移动友好:确保网页在各种设备上都能良好显示。

2. 定期更新和备份

为了保持网页的安全性和功能性,定期更新内容和备份文件是必要的:

  • 内容更新:定期添加新内容,保持网站活跃。
  • 安全更新:及时更新网页和服务器软件,防止安全漏洞。
  • 数据备份:定期备份网站文件和数据库,以防数据丢失。

六、使用项目管理系统

在网页发布过程中,团队协作和项目管理至关重要。推荐使用以下两种系统:

  1. 研发项目管理系统PingCode:适合技术团队,提供代码管理、任务跟踪、版本控制等功能。
  2. 通用项目协作软件Worktile:适合各种规模的团队,提供任务管理、时间跟踪、团队协作等功能。

通过有效的项目管理系统,可以提高团队效率,确保网页发布过程顺利进行。

总结

发布一个HTML5网页涉及多个步骤,从编写代码到选择合适的Web主机,再到上传文件和设置域名解析。每一步都需要仔细规划和执行,以确保网页能够顺利上线并提供良好的用户体验。通过合理的优化和维护,可以确保网页长期稳定运行。使用项目管理系统还可以提高团队协作效率,确保项目按计划进行。

相关问答FAQs:

1. 如何创建一个HTML5网页?

  • 首先,您需要使用文本编辑器(如Notepad++、Sublime Text等)创建一个新的文件,并将其保存为以.html为扩展名的文件。
  • 其次,您需要编写HTML代码来构建网页的内容和结构。您可以使用各种HTML元素和标签来添加标题、段落、图像、链接等。
  • 然后,您可以使用CSS样式表来美化您的网页。通过为元素添加样式,您可以设置字体、颜色、背景等属性,以使网页具有吸引力。
  • 最后,您可以使用JavaScript来为网页添加交互功能。通过编写脚本,您可以实现表单验证、动画效果、响应式设计等。

2. HTML5网页有哪些新特性和优势?

  • HTML5引入了许多新的元素和API,使开发者能够更好地构建现代化的网页应用。其中一些新特性包括语义化元素(如

  • HTML5还提供了更好的跨平台和跨设备兼容性。无论您是在桌面、移动设备还是平板电脑上浏览网页,HTML5都能提供更一致的用户体验。
  • 此外,HTML5还支持离线访问,通过使用应用程序缓存,您可以使网页在没有网络连接的情况下仍然可访问。

3. 如何将HTML5网页发布到互联网上?

  • 首先,您需要选择一个Web托管服务提供商,并注册一个域名。域名是您网站的唯一标识,例如www.yourwebsite.com。
  • 其次,您需要将您的HTML5文件上传到托管服务提供商提供的服务器上。通常,您可以使用FTP(文件传输协议)客户端来实现文件上传。
  • 然后,您需要配置您的域名指向您所选择的托管服务提供商的服务器。这通常涉及到将域名解析到正确的IP地址上。
  • 最后,您需要等待DNS(域名系统)的传播时间,通常需要24-48小时,以使您的网站在全球范围内都可以访问。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2965904

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部